The Fife Trojans will square off against the Foss Falcons at 7:00 p.m. on Friday. Foss took a loss in their last game and will be looking to turn the tables on Fife, who comes in off a win.
Having struggled with three losses in a row, Fife turned things around against Orting on Tuesday. They escaped with a win against the Cardinals by the margin of a single free throw, 56-55.
Meanwhile, it's never fun to lose, and it's even less fun to lose 87-36, which was the final score in Foss' tilt against Franklin Pierce on Tuesday. While losing is never fun, the Falcons can't take it too hard given the team's big disadvantage in MaxPreps' Washington basketball rankings (they are ranked 294th, while the Cardinals are ranked 122nd).
Fife pushed their record up to 7-10 with the win, which was their third straight on the road. The wins came thanks to their offensive performance across that stretch, as they averaged 61.7 points per game. As for Foss, their defeat dropped their record down to 8-10.
Fife came out on top in a nail-biter against Foss when the teams last played on January 7th, sneaking past 64-61. Will Fife repeat their success, or does Foss have a new game plan this time around? We'll find out soon enough.
